Ed Jorgenson Joins Shafter Station Staff
E C Ed Jorgenson nematologist has joined Shafter Station to fill the vacancy left by Dr Fields Caveness in 1969. He arrives from Logan Utah where he did nematology research and taught at Utah State Experiment Station. The family resides in Wasco with six children.

Shafter Council Approves Budget and City Plans
The Shafter city council approved a balanced $622 451 75 budget for 1970 71 with an 84 624 25 carryover from 1969 70 to cushion revenue gaps. The plan includes a 5 percent across the board cost of living increase and a 1.5 percent salary boost, raises money for retirement funding, and a 1.79 tax rate to remain unchanged for now. Capital outlays include city hall 1505 and police and public works expenditures while spending shows 92.61 percent of 1969 70 budget used and 28.59 percent of capital outlay. The vote followed street and recreation issues, with Nort Shafter Avenue improvement approved.

Staley to Speak at Kern NFO Meeting Next Saturday
Orin Lee Staley national president of the National Farmers Organization will address Kern NFO members July 18 at 7 30 p.m. in the auditorium Marvin Weidenbach Kern NFO president announced the appearance urging members to bring wives and fellow farmers Staley operates a farm in northwest Missouri and raises purebred short horn cattle.

Penner To Head Richland School Board In 1970 71
Dr Voth resigns from the Richland board with Henry Voth stepping down after eight years. Arthur J Penner elected president at the July 7 reorganizational meeting while Phillip Zachary departs the chair. Fred Starrh named clerk and Supt Cooke keeps secretary duties. Regular meetings set and budget talk begins.

Driver Cited In Collision In Wasco
Bill Kirkley of Wasco was cited for failure to yield at the Central Valley Highway Lerdo Avenue intersection after a two car collision. W. E. and Mrs Ward were hospitalized in Bakersfield for injuries. Bill Deckert of Rosalee was charged with theft of a $27 car battery.

Ground-Breaking Planned For Shafter Starch Plant
Ground breaking for Western Polymer Corporation’s starch plant near Shafter is set for late fall at 30700 San Diego Street in Mexican Colony. Jim Gamlen says the plant will start within 120 days of groundbreaking, employ about 50 workers, process potatoes for starch and produce by products, with a future expansion to wastewater chemicals and related equipment.
